Transaction 139f433c2caa1f1bccbdb67db8ae9a97eeba48d1e4f37c0a17054ba59037631e
1 Input
2 Outputs
- 139f433c2caa1f1bccbdb67db8ae9a97eeba48d1e4f37c0a17054ba59037631e:0
- 139f433c2caa1f1bccbdb67db8ae9a97eeba48d1e4f37c0a17054ba59037631e:1
value 5570000
address 3HU2RSirA6ckuCDgJBgzc5W27pkrFuK6bq
value 16491670
address 13pKbP51f2fwuh8HT3zfPTpc9jg5FZghmz